The Georgia Department of Labor is holding an online event promoting resources designed to assist employers in hiring workes with disabilities. It’s scheduled for Wednsday, September 28 from 11:30 AM to 1:30 PM. ( I assume that would be local Georgia time.)
From an announcement published in the Loganville-GraysonPatch.
During the chat, information will be provided on such subjects as the Work Opportunity Tax Credit (WOTC) program for employers, Job Accommodation Network (JAN) on workplace accommodations and how to eliminate barriers to employment. It will also provide information on resources to pay for assistive technology, workplace and classroom training, the Ontario Associations Supporting Individuals with Special Needs (OASIS) program on career guidance and respect for people with disabilities.
